What is the difference between the presentation covers and the hinged portfolio?

0

Presentation covers are a set of covers available in A4 and A3 portrait or landscape. They are made of black book paper and take standard 2 hole and 4 hole punched sheets. Screws are sold separately and come in different lengths according to the number of sheets to be inserted. Also available with a metal front cover. Hinged portfolios are available in A4 portrait and A3 portrait and landscape. They are covered in book cloth and have 10 plastic sleeves with inner black card which hold A4 or A3 sheets. They are held together with silver screws. Extra sleeves are available in packs of 10. The hinged portfolios come in black, grey, red or with a metal front cover.
